Obituary For Mary Ellen Chilenski

Mary Ellen Chilenski, 91, was peacefully welcomed into the loving hands of our Lord on June 1, 2010 at her residence in South Texas. Mary Ellen was the matriarch of the Mihalyo/Chilenski families of the Ohio Valley. She was born August 2, 1918 in Mingo Junction and resided most of her life in the Steubenville and Wintersville area. Her lifelong dedication to her family and her determination to help them succeed has been instilled into all the generations that have prospered under her guidance. Mary was preceded in death by her husband of 56 years, Walter; son Patrick; son-in-law, Robert Hagerty; brothers John & Andrew Mihalyo; and sisters Elizabeth Seals & Ann Pethe. She is survived by sons, Walter (Kathy) of St. Louis, MO and James (Susan) of Lancaster, OH, and daughters Ladonna (Richard) Delatore of Steubenville, Rita (William) Bourne of Rochester, MN, Marjorie Hagerty of Brandon, FL, and Frances (Lawrence) Wolpin of Arroyo City, TX.,  brothers Michael (Nancy) Mihalyo and Regis (Mary) Mihalyo; and a sister Regina Mihalyo.
